How is CBD extracted?

CBD is a natural chemical compound that is found naturally in the cannabis plant. It is among the most widely used cannabinoids and is believed to have many benefits. It is used to treat inflammation, pain anxiety disorders and arthritis.

When buying a product containing CBD it is essential to understand where it came from. You should also carefully read the label, as there are many types of CBD products Some of which might not even be legal in your state.

Hemp-derived CBD is derived from industrial hemp plants that are controlled by U.S. law to contain no more than 0.3 percent tetrahydrocannabinol (THC) in dry weight. The Farm Bill 2018, which removed hemp from the federal government’s list of controlled substances made it legal to grow and sell CBD-based products across the nation.

It is still illegal to cultivate or sell marijuana in the United States. This distinction is crucial as it affects how legal CBD products are marketed and sold in the United States.

While hemp-based CBD products are fairly easy to find but marijuana-based CBD goods are only available in states where adult-use or medical cannabis is legal. Many people are turning to CBD-derived hemp products to improve their health and well-being.
